CALABRIA, Tarentum. Circa 290-281 BC. AR Nomos (19mm, 7.65 g, 3h). Warrior, holding shield and two spears, preparing to cast a third, on horseback right; ΦIΛI below / Phalanthos, holding dolphin and distaff, riding dolphin left; ΦI to left, ivy-leaf to right, waves below. Fischer-Bossert Group 79, 1095 (V410/R838); Vlasto 591–2 (same obv. die); HN Italy 934. VF, toned, struck with worn obverse die.
